Smile That Took Away My Heart
That one smile which stole my heart….
She knew to live, she knew this art.
Outside that small, broken, tented hut,
There were puddles and stench, she knew but….
It's not worth worrying, it doesn’t need care
Her feet were bare,
Her clothes were torn,
Her face was flushed with laughter,
Her hair played around her cheeks
But who had the time to look after…
She was probably used to spend
Days and nights with an empty stomach.
But her eyes were full of joy
And so seemed her soul was without any ache.
Her empty hands were full,
Her lips didn’t seem to be dull.
Her spirits were high and I could read
The hope and optimism in her heart’s seed.
Her bright eyes said aloud,
You can’t be thrashed or dumped down in the crowd
Unless you accept defeat.
No one dare put you in the back seat.
Her unsaid words told me clear and straight
Misery can take away the roof on her head
But no one can take away the earth below her feet.
